Isolation.

Loch Assynt, Inverpolly, Sutherland.

A lonely isolated castle on a grassy plinth at the southern end of Loch Assynt. The sky was delightful, the foreground less so. I dedicated 80% of the picture to the sky and let the wee castle feel small within this giant landscape. It was the differential lighting that allowed the castle to be so pleasantly revealed against the dark wedge of hill behind it and it was a devil of a job finding a point where I could keep the lit castle within the boundaries of the hill behind.

Pentax 67 II ,55-100 zoom,Fujichrome Velvia
F16 at 1/8 sec, polariser and 0.3ND grad to water surface. full exif
